Luke McCaffrey suffered a significant injury during the Washington Commanders’ matchup against the Seattle Seahawks on Sunday night.

McCaffrey was expected to play a key role in the Commanders’ offense alongside quarterback Jayden Daniels. Additionally, the team was missing star receiver Terry McLaurin due to injury, which would have likely increased McCaffrey’s involvement throughout the game.

However, McCaffrey’s time on the field was cut short early in the first quarter. While participating on special teams during the opening kickoff, he suffered a shoulder injury. According to ESPN’s NFL insider Adam Schefter, this injury will sideline McCaffrey for the remainder of the game.

“Commanders ruled out Luke McCaffrey due to a shoulder injury,” Schefter reported.
